
Wing Eli Walker has pulled out of Wales’ World Cup squad because of a hamstring injury.
The once-capped Ospreys player, 25, was himself a late call-up after full-back Leigh Halfpenny was ruled out of the quad through knee injury.
It comes after scrum-half Rhys Webb’s earlier withdrawal.
Twice-capped Gloucester back-rower Ross Moriarty, 21, who has taken Walker’s place, tweeted: “Feel for @EliWalker24 having to miss out because of injury.”
He added: “Unbelievably thankful to be given a call-up and can’t wait to get back involved.” - BBC
